摘要

目的 为了实现颜色光谱到设备相关颜色空间的特征化。方法 采用一种RBF网络和立方体等级细分相结合的方法,构建LCD显示器颜色光谱到RGB数值转换模型。结果 客观验证343个颜色光谱反向转换的平均色差为0.61,最大色差为2.62。结论 该模型是一种精度较高的反向特征化模型。

Abstract

The work aims to achieve the characterization of color spectrum to the device-related color space. RBF network and cube class subdivision were combined to construct a model for LCD display color spectrum to be converted into RGB numerical values. Based on objective verification, the average color difference of 343 reversely converted color spectra was 0.61 and the maximum color difference was 2.62. In conclusion, the proposed model is a model of higher precision and reverse characterization.
